On Saturday, Feb 3 2006, Tom McNeil, JT McNeil, and myself checked out the
birds on Middlebrook lake.  In steady sleet we saw three species of
Merganser - Common Merganser, Red-breasted Mergansers 2, and Hooded
Mergansers 150+.  We also saw a huge population of mainly Ring-billed gulls
(we didn't look at each one real close).  The gulls were on the center of
Middlebrook Lake and took flight soon as we pulled up. -- Sullivan County,
TN.

We then drove to Clear Creek Lake (in Virginia - Wallace Community)where we
saw another 150+ Hooded Mergansers, a Belted Kingfisher, Great Blue Heron,
White-fronted Geese 3, and a single Ross' Goose.  The White-fronted Geese
and Ross' Goose was in a small flock of Canada Geese and have been in this
part of Bristol, VA for a couple of months now.  -- Washington County, VA.
